JASN_DE@lemmy.worldto Selfhosted@lemmy.world•How often do you run backups on your system?English5·5 months agoNextcloud data daily, same for the docker configs. Less important/rarely changing data once per week. Automatic sync to NAS and online storage. Irregular and manual sync to an external disk.
7 daily backups, 4 weekly backups, “infinite” monthly backups retained (until I clean them up by hand).
